Female nude with Death as a skeleton, 1897 (etching)
990955 Female nude with Death as a skeleton, 1897 (etching) by Rassenfosse, Armand (1862-1934); 28x21.5 cm; Private Collection; (add.info.: Female nude with Death as a skeleton. From Les Fleurs du Mal, by Charles Baudelaire. Illustrated by Armand Rassenfosse (1862-1934). Etching. Signed and dated 1897 (in the original). Published, Paris, 1899. 28 x 21.5cm.); Photo eChristies Images; Belgian, out of copyright

This black and white etching, titled "Female nude with Death as a skeleton" is a thought-provoking piece of art created by Belgian artist Armand Rassenfosse in 1897. The print measures 28x21.5 cm and belongs to a private collection. The image depicts a female figure standing amidst a woodland setting, her naked body exposed for all to see. However, what makes this artwork truly intriguing is the presence of Death personified as a skeleton, embracing the woman in an intimate kiss. This juxtaposition between life and death creates an unsettling yet mesmerizing visual narrative. Rassenfosse's inspiration for this work comes from Charles Baudelaire's renowned book Les Fleurs du Mal (The Flowers of Evil). The etching serves as an illustration for one of Baudelaire's poems that explores themes of mortality and the fragility of human existence. The artist's skillful use of lines and shading brings depth and texture to the composition, while also emphasizing the contrasting elements within it. The delicate portrayal of the female form against the starkness of Death adds to its symbolic power. This late nineteenth-century artwork continues to captivate viewers with its exploration of negative concepts such as mortality and vulnerability. It stands as a testament to Rassenfosse's artistic prowess and his ability to evoke strong emotions through his work.
